Israeli attacks on Gaza kill dozens near aid centers and shelters

Dozens are killed as the Israeli occupation targets aid centers, shelters, and homes in Gaza amid a worsening humanitarian disaster and rising civilian casualties.

The Israeli occupation forces have intensified their ongoing aggression on the Gaza Strip, launching a series of deadly airstrikes and artillery bombardments that have targeted residential areas, aid distribution centers, and displaced persons camps, resulting in dozens of martyrs and injuries amid a near-total humanitarian collapse.

Al Mayadeen’s correspondent reported that Israeli forces opened fire on civilians near a US aid distribution point north of Rafah, killing six Palestinians and injuring over ten others. The attack was one of the deadliest in recent hours and forms part of a broader pattern of targeting aid-dependent civilians.

Additional strikes claimed lives in northern areas of Gaza City and al-Nuseirat refugee camp, where civilians had gathered in anticipation of receiving humanitarian aid. Reports confirmed casualties in both locations.

Residential areas, shelters under fire

Simultaneously, Israeli warplanes bombed civilian homes in al-Zawaida in central Gaza, the Hamad residential complex, and the western Sattir area in northern Khan Younis. Further airstrikes hit Beit Lahia and Jabalia in northern Gaza, killing and injuring dozens, many of them women and children.

In the displacement tents of al-Mawasi, west of Khan Younis, airstrikes struck civilian gatherings, causing several injuries in what was considered a safe zone under international law. Another strike on a home near the Ain Jalut towers in al-Nuseirat led to the death of a child and left several others wounded.

Humanitarian catastrophe unfolds

According to the Palestinian Ministry of Health in Gaza, the total number of martyrs has risen to 55,959, with 131,242 injuries since the Israeli aggression began on October 7, 2023. The Ministry added that 51 martyrs and 104 injuries were recorded over 24 hours alone.

Many victims remain trapped under rubble and in streets inaccessible to emergency teams due to the ongoing bombardment and severe shortages of rescue equipment. The Ministry warned of an intensifying humanitarian disaster as relief efforts collapse under sustained attacks.

Field reports stress that the Israeli occupation’s deliberate targeting of aid centers and displaced persons camps marks a dangerous escalation in the nature of the assault on Gaza. 

Airstrikes target tents sheltering the displaced

The bombing campaign extended to southern Gaza as well. In Khan Younis, five Palestinians were killed when Israeli forces struck a tent sheltering displaced families in the al-Mawasi area. The victims were among thousands who had fled their homes due to the ongoing assault and were living without adequate protection or humanitarian support.

In central Gaza, the al-Awda Hospital reported that eight wounded Palestinians were brought in following an Israeli strike on a group of people waiting for aid along Salah al-Din Road, south of Wadi Gaza.

These attacks come amid the Israeli regime’s relentless assault on the Gaza Strip, which continues to deepen the humanitarian crisis. Essential supplies remain critically scarce, while tens of thousands of displaced residents are crammed into overcrowded shelters or open areas with no protection or access to aid.

Renewed massacres

Israeli occupation forces are committing new massacres in the Gaza Strip, targeting civilian homes, locations, and aid distribution centers as part of their ongoing aggression, which has persisted for over a year and a half.

On Friday, the Israeli occupation carried out a new series of massacres against Palestinian civilians in Gaza, killing at least 40 and injuring over 120, including women and children, in strikes targeting multiple areas across the Strip.

Al Mayadeen's correspondent reported that 12 Palestinians were killed in an Israeli airstrike targeting a home in Deir al-Balah in central Gaza, while three others were killed and several wounded in a drone attack on civilians near the Sheikh Radwan cemetery west of Gaza City.
